In the Appearance panel, the word “Group” appears at the top. With the group se-
lected, you can now apply appearance attributes to the group and they will appear
in the panel. The word “Contents” also appears below the word “Group.” If you
were to double-click the word “Contents” in the Appearance panel, you would see
the appearance attributes of the individual items in the group.
Tip
You can view all hidden attributes by choosing Show All Hidden Attrib-
utes from the Appearance panel menu.
Adding another stroke and fill
Artwork in Illustrator can have more than one stroke and fill applied to it to add interesting
design elements. You'll now add another fill to an object using the Appearance panel.
Note
The figure has the Fill row toggled open revealing the content. Yours may
not look like that, and that's okay.
1. With the trumpet group still selected, click the Add New Fill button ( ) at the
bottom of the Appearance panel. The first part of the figure shows what the panel
looks like after clicking the Add New Fill button.
